
Mobile Payment transactions to reach $670 Billion by 2015
July 5, 2011
According to a new study by Juniper Research, the value of NFC purchases or “near-field communications” will reach $670 billion by 2015 for mobile-sourced money transfers, and mobile payments for digital and physical goods.
That’s represents a shift upward from the $240 billion Juniper Research has predicted for the total value of mobile payments in 2011. Juniper finds that during the next 18 months, 20 countries will begin deploying NFC payment systems and services; transactions from those services will be in the ballpark of $50 billion by 2014.
The new Mobile Payments Strategies report revealed that all segments will exhibit 2x to 3x growth over the next five years. This growth will be driven by the rapid adoption of mobile ticketing, NFC contactless payments, physical goods purchases and money transfers as people in both developed and developing countries use their devices for everyday transactions.
Recently, Google announced its Google Wallet and Google Deals services in the U.S., and the search giant has large retail partners on board, including Citi, Subway, Mastercard, Sprint, Macys, and Walgreens. The Far East and China, Western Europe, and North America are the largest mobile payment regions, and those areas “will represent 75% of the global mobile payment gross transaction value by 2015,” the report said.
